Output ccaabe28dab9989968fc6a5ac853b4bc078ee00a897ceea17ecbb7d49a046933:5

value
535137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ca303c26de4e416c54537cf3df708ad25f883223 OP_EQUAL
address
3L86Cib3ydggfucULSmKr1QbMH96ETMxSb
transaction
ccaabe28dab9989968fc6a5ac853b4bc078ee00a897ceea17ecbb7d49a046933
confirmations
278465
spent
true